Как построены тестовые среды создания

Как построены тестовые среды создания

Испытательная окружение разработки является собой обособленное пространство для испытания программного программ. Инженеры создают обособленную инфраструктуру, которая копирует реальные параметры эксплуатации программы. Подобная инфраструктура объединяет серверы, базы данных, сетевые составляющие и иные технологические элементы.

Команды проектирования используют казино без депозита для безопасного тестирования свежих функций. Обособленное окружение обеспечивает возможность валидировать код без опасности повредить работающий продукт. Эксперты активируют приложение в регулируемых параметрах и изучают его работу.

Построение испытательного среды повторяет архитектуру производственной системы. Специалисты регулируют параметры, развертывают зависимости и создают информацию для валидации. Каждый компонент приложения призван выполняться подобно рабочей версии.

Процесс развертывания проверочного среды требует немалых ресурсов. Организации резервируют процессорные мощности, базы информации и сетевую структуру. Корректно настроенная инфраструктура помогает находить баги на ранних периодах разработки. Качественное испытание минимизирует количество дефектов в конечном релизе приложения.

Зачем необходимы изолированные среды для проверки

Обособленные среды для испытания защищают производственные системы от непрогнозируемых итогов. Обновленный код вероятно включать фатальные ошибки, которые вызовут к сбоям в эксплуатации системы. Отдельное пространство помогает выявить неполадки до их выхода к итоговым пользователям.

Специалисты пробуют с разнообразными способами внедрения опций. Тестовое пространство дает свободу испытывать необычные решения без опасений ущемить делу. Группы могут возвращать правки и инициировать тестирование снова в удобный период.

Одновременная деятельность множества специалистов предполагает обособленных окружений. Каждый разработчик валидирует свои правки, не препятствуя товарищам. Разделение предотвращает противоречия между отличающимися редакциями казино и ускоряет процесс разработки.

Защита информации потребителей сохраняется первостепенной задачей при испытании. Реальная информация клиентов не обязана использоваться в опытах. Отдельная система взаимодействует с фиктивными данными, которые воспроизводят действительные сведения. Такой прием устраняет раскрытия конфиденциальной сведений и исполняет условия законодательства о охране индивидуальных сведений.

Чем испытательная платформа различается от продуктовой

Тестовая инфраструктура задействует урезанную конфигурацию по сравнению с боевой средой. Компании сберегают средства, резервируя меньше серверных средств для проверки приложения. Рабочее пространство выполняет обращения тысяч клиентов одновременно, тогда как тестовое пространство ориентировано на ограниченную нагрузку.

Данные в испытательной платформе представляют собой программно сформированные данные. Специалисты генерируют информацию, которая дублирует архитектуру реальных данных заказчиков. Продуктовая хранилище хранит актуальные сведения потребителей и нуждается повышенных средств охраны.

Наблюдение и логирование выполняются различно в двух видах сред. Тестовое пространство накапливает исчерпывающую сведения о каждой действии для анализа казино онлайн и нахождения неполадок. Продуктовая среда фиксирует только серьезные случаи, чтобы не переполнять хранилища данных.

Право к испытательной системе имеют разработчики и эксперты по контролю. Рабочее окружение предоставлено для реальных потребителей и запрашивает пристального контроля модификаций. Всякое обновление производственной среды проходит поэтапное согласование, тогда как тестовая платформа дает возможность оперативно делать модификации для тестов.

Как создаются копии систем для тестирования

Процесс разворачивания копии программы начинается с дублирования оригинального программы из репозитория. Инженеры скачивают актуальную итерацию приложения и помещают компоненты на тестовых узлах. Инструмент отслеживания итераций обеспечивает указать необходимую версию для установки.

Параметрические данные адаптируются под требования тестового пространства. Специалисты указывают пути баз данных, конфигурации сетевых каналов и технические параметры. Грамотная настройка предоставляет правильную эксплуатацию продукта в обособленном пространстве.

База информации копируется с применением утилит копирования. Команды формируют снимок продуктовой базы и переносят схему таблиц в проверочное хранилище. Приватные данные заменяются замаскированными данными для следования правил защиты.

Автоматизация установки стимулирует создание казино и снижает риск неточностей. Автоматизации реализуют операции для установки зависимостей и инициализации процессов. Контейнеризация помогает инкапсулировать систему в автономный модуль. Подобный способ предоставляет единообразие окружений на разнообразных этапах разработки.

Какие категории проверочных платформ существуют

Пространство создания рассчитана для формирования и исправления софта специалистами. Каждый сотрудник работает на локальном устройстве или выделенном сервере. Инженеры моментально вносят обновления и проверяют ключевую работоспособность компонентов.

Интеграционная инфраструктура сливает код от нескольких участников группы. Платформа без участия компилирует программу и инициирует валидации совместимости модулей. Этот категория окружения обнаруживает столкновения между модулями казино без депозита на первой периоде.

Среда валидации эксплуатируется специалистами по тестированию для подробной валидации функций. Проверяющие реализуют варианты эксплуатации и документируют найденные баги. Платформа хранит стабильную итерацию решения для систематического анализа.

Предпродакшн система предельно близка к продуктовой платформе. Коллективы выполняют конечную тестирование перед развертыванием апдейтов. Подобное окружение помогает определить недостатки скорости и совместимости с действующей инфраструктурой.

Показательная система создается для выступлений заказчикам. Окружение содержит подготовленные сведения и сконфигурированные кейсы демонстрации функциональности продукта.

Как валидируются новые возможности

Испытание новых функциональности инициируется с изучения условий к формируемому элементу. Тестировщики исследуют материалы и формируют реестр проверок для валидации функционирования платформы. Каждая функция обязана соответствовать указанным требованиям.

Юнит проверка испытывает изолированные фрагменты софта в отдельности. Специалисты пишут программные тесты, которые вызывают процедуры и сопоставляют результаты с планируемыми данными. Подобный способ дает возможность незамедлительно определять ошибки в структуре софта.

Интеграционное проверка оценивает сопряжение новой функции с существующими модулями. Группы проверяют передачу сведений между модулями и правильность выполнения вызовов. Эксперты эксплуатируют средства для воспроизведения разнообразных кейсов казино функционирования.

Функциональное проверка выполняется с угла взгляда итогового пользователя. Эксперты воспроизводят обычные сценарии применения и испытывают совпадение данных ожиданиям. Группа документирует найденные отклонения для корректировки.

Регрессионное проверка подтверждает, что обновленный код не испортил эксплуатацию действующей возможностей.

Почему необходимо отделять неполадки

Отделение неполадок устраняет расползание ошибок на производственную платформу. Критическая неполадка в производственной среде вероятно повлечь к потере данных потребителей и блокировке операций. Проверочное среда обеспечивает выявить проблему до ее доступа к потребителям.

Локализация багов стимулирует процесс их устранения. Инженеры четко идентифицируют компонент с ошибкой и сосредотачиваются на правке специфического блока программы. Отдельная проверка предотвращает вмешательство остальных модулей казино онлайн на данные изучения.

Проверочная платформа формирует защищенное пространство для экспериментов с корректировками. Команды проверяют множественные методы устранения без угрозы ухудшить обстановку.

Локализация багов создает нижеперечисленные преимущества:

  • Сохранение репутации организации от плохих комментариев;
  • Минимизация финансовых издержек от отказа системы;
  • Обеспечение доверия заказчиков к продукту;
  • Минимизация времени на поиск источника неполадки.

Описание изолированных дефектов способствует исключить повторение проблем в перспективе. Команды исследуют причины дефектов и улучшают методы разработки.

Как коллективы функционируют с испытательными платформами

Группы проектирования применяют механизм управления входом для взаимодействия с испытательными пространствами. Каждый сотрудник приобретает регистрационные сведения с определенными возможностями в зависимости от роли. Инженеры размещают софт, специалисты стартуют проверки, администраторы обслуживают структурой.

Процесс установки обновлений следует определенному порядку. Разработчики фиксируют софт в хранилище и создают обращение на интеграцию. Программная механизм компилирует продукт и размещает измененную итерацию в тестовом окружении.

Синхронизация между членами реализуется через механизм отслеживания поручений. Разработчики фиксируют определенные неполадки, устанавливают ответственных и отслеживают прогресс заданий. Открытость методов позволяет оптимально организовывать казино средства и мониторить временные рамки.

Плановые сессии группы анализируют результаты тестирования и определяют предстоящие операции. Члены распространяют данными о неполадках и вносят подходы. Коллективная деятельность ускоряет устранение дефектов.

Регламентация практик содействует новым работникам быстро изучить оперирование с тестовыми пространствами.

Важность тестовых окружений в устойчивости продукта

Испытательные среды создают фундамент для гарантии стабильности программного решения. Систематическая испытание правок в изолированном окружении снижает число багов в производственной среде. Группы выявляют фатальные ошибки до развертывания и устраняют отрицательное влияние на потребителей.

Систематическое испытание поддерживает хорошее состояние программной базы. Программные тесты активируются вслед за каждого апдейта и сигнализируют о проблемах совместимости. Инженеры приобретают обратную связь о эффекте правок на работу казино онлайн среды.

Определенность реакции системы получается через поэтапное испытание. Каждая возможность получает валидацию на разных стадиях в специализированных платформах. Системный подход обеспечивает соответствие решения критериям уровня.

Снижение опасностей при развертывании изменений казино без депозита зависит от тщательности валидации. Команды применяют препродуктовую платформу для итоговой проверки перед размещением. Данная подход охраняет дело от материальных издержек.

Долгосрочная устойчивость приложения требует постоянного улучшения практик проверки и развития структуры.

Submit your response

Your email address will not be published. Required fields are marked *